Evaluation of Aloe Vera Extract Loaded Polyvinyl Alcohol Nanofiber Webs Obtained via Needleless Electrospinning
IOP Conference Series: Materials Science and Engineering 2018
Sandra Jēgina, Silvija Kukle, Jānis Grāvītis

In this study aloe vera liquid extract was added to PVA to obtain nanofiber mats with integrated bioactive compounds. Nanofibers are effective in drug release process and the most cost and time effective way to produce them is through roller electrospinning method. Several concentrations of PVA and aloe vera extract have been prepared, as well as pure 10 wt% polyvinyl alcohol solution to compare their properties. Viscosity and electroconductivity of solutions were measured, atomic force microscopy was used for evaluation of nanofiber mats morphology and diameter measurements, samples were analysed and compared by Fourier transform infrared spectroscopy and mechanical properties of the nanofiber mats were tested.
